vite vue3 ts 项目搭建
时间: 2023-04-04 17:01:38 浏览: 285
你好,关于 vite vue3 ts 项目搭建,我可以回答你的问题。首先,你需要安装最新版本的 Node.js 和 npm。然后,使用 npm 安装 Vite:npm install -g vite。接着,使用 Vite 创建一个新项目:vite create my-project --template vue-ts。这将创建一个基于 Vue3 和 TypeScript 的项目。你可以在项目中使用 Vue3 的新特性,如 Composition API 和 Teleport。同时,Vite 的快速热更新和构建速度也会让你的开发效率大大提高。希望这个回答能够帮到你。
相关问题
vite vue3 ts 项目搭建 H5
### 使用 Vite、Vue3 和 TypeScript 搭建 H5 项目
#### 初始化项目
为了创建一个新的基于 Vite 的 Vue3 项目并启用 TypeScript 支持,可以采用官方推荐的方式:
```bash
npm create vite@latest my-vue-app --template vue-ts
cd my-vue-app
npm install
```
这会设置好基础结构,包括必要的依赖项以及配置文件[^3]。
#### 启动开发服务器
一旦项目建立完成,可以通过执行如下命令来启动本地开发服务器:
```bash
npm run dev
```
此操作利用了 Vite 提供的强大热更新功能,在修改源码时能够迅速反映更改[^1]。
#### 构建生产版本
当准备部署应用时,需先编译 TypeScript 文件再进行打包:
```bash
npm run build
```
该过程不仅完成了 JavaScript 到浏览器兼容代码的转换工作,还优化了最终产物以适应线上环境的需求。
#### 查看构建成果
对于已经构建好的应用程序,可借助预览服务直观感受实际表现:
```bash
npm run preview
```
这项特性允许开发者在模拟真实场景下测试网页性能和交互逻辑。
#### 配置环境变量
根据不同阶段(如开发、测试或发布),可通过 `.env` 文件系列自定义全局可用的环境参数。例如,在`.env.h5` 中指定特定于移动端 Web 应用程序的设定:
```plaintext
NODE_ENV=production
VITE_APP_TITLE=My App (staging)
VITE_BUILD_MODE=h5
```
这些值会被注入到前端代码里作为常量使用,有助于区分不同上下文下的行为差异[^2]。
#### 扩展功能集
随着项目的成长,可能还需要加入更多组件库和技术栈支持。比如集成路由管理器 `vue-router` 或状态管理系统 `Pinia` 来增强用户体验;或是引入样式预处理器 SCSS 实现更灵活的主题定制方案。另外,考虑到 API 请求处理方面的要求,则应该考虑封装 Axios 并为其添加类型安全机制[^5]。
vite vue3 js项目搭建
### 使用Vite和Vue3搭建JavaScript项目
#### 安装依赖包
为了创建一个新的基于 Vite 和 Vue 3 的 JavaScript 项目,需先安装 Node.js 及 npm 或 yarn。之后,在命令行工具中执行如下指令来初始化新项目并安装必要的开发依赖项:
```bash
npm init vite@latest my-vue-app --template vue
cd my-vite-app
npm install
```
这段代码会利用 `vite` 创建模板工程,并指定使用 Vue 模板[^1]。
#### 修改配置文件
项目的根目录下有一个名为 `vite.config.js` 的配置文件,其定义了构建行为和其他设置。对于希望集成 ESLint 插件以及设定路径别名的情况,可以按照下面的方式调整该文件的内容:
```javascript
import { defineConfig } from 'vite';
import vue from '@vitejs/plugin-vue';
import eslintPlugin from 'vite-plugin-eslint';
export default defineConfig({
plugins: [
vue(),
eslintPlugin({
include: ['src/**/*.ts', 'src/**/*.vue', 'src/*.ts', 'src/*.vue'],
}),
],
resolve: {
alias: {
'@': '/src',
},
}
});
```
此段脚本引入了两个插件——一个是用于支持 `.vue` 文件解析的官方插件;另一个则是用来在开发期间自动检测 TypeScript 和 Vue 组件中的潜在错误或不符合编码风格的地方。
#### 启动本地服务器
完成上述操作后,可以通过运行以下命令启动内置的发展模式下的 HTTP 服务端口,默认情况下它会在浏览器打开地址 http://localhost:3000 显示应用界面:
```bash
npm run dev
```
这将激活热重载功能以便于实时预览所做的更改效果。
阅读全文
相关推荐












